Tunbridge Wells Core Strategy Review - Response to Consultation

Minutes

The report recommended a response to Tunbridge Wells Borough Council's consultation on the review of its Local Development Framework Core Strategy. It was noted that the review focused on certain matters, primarily relating to housing numbers.

Members suggested that extra emphasis and strength be given to highlighting the significant danger of pursuing the review based upon existing information, as the robustness of the evidence base and the soundness of the replacement policies could be prone to challenge. In addition, Members asked that ongoing engagement be sought with Tunbridge Wells Borough Council during the development of the Core Strategy.

Following consideration by the Planning and Transportation Advisory Board, the Cabinet Member for Planning and Transportation resolved that the views on Tunbridge Wells Borough Council's Core Strategy Review document (May 2011), as set out in the report, be transmitted to Tunbridge Wells Borough Council in response to its consultation, subject to strengthening the comments as outlined above.

Reasons: As set out in the report submitted to the Planning and Transportation Advisory Board of 14 June 2011.
